在科技飞速发展的今天,机器人已经成为我们生活中不可或缺的一部分。而机器人的“眼睛”——视觉系统,是其感知世界、执行任务的关键。那么,机器人眼睛是如何看世界的呢?稳态视觉技术又如何让机器更敏锐地洞察周围环境?下面,我们就来揭开这些问题的神秘面纱。
机器人视觉系统概述
机器人视觉系统主要由传感器、处理器和执行器三部分组成。传感器负责捕捉图像信息,处理器对图像信息进行处理和分析,而执行器则根据处理结果执行相应的动作。
传感器
机器人视觉系统常用的传感器有摄像头、激光雷达、红外传感器等。其中,摄像头是最常见的传感器,它可以捕捉二维图像信息;激光雷达则可以获取三维空间信息;红外传感器则可以探测物体发出的红外辐射。
处理器
处理器是机器人视觉系统的核心,它负责对传感器捕捉到的图像信息进行处理和分析。常见的处理器有CPU、GPU、FPGA等。处理器通过图像处理算法,如边缘检测、特征提取、目标识别等,将图像信息转化为机器人可以理解的信号。
执行器
执行器根据处理器分析结果,执行相应的动作。例如,当机器人识别出障碍物时,它会通过执行器调整行驶方向,避免碰撞。
稳态视觉技术
稳态视觉技术是一种让机器人能够在动态环境中保持视觉稳定性的技术。它通过以下方式实现:
1. 预测与补偿
稳态视觉系统会根据物体的运动轨迹和速度,预测其未来位置,并提前对图像进行补偿,以保持视觉稳定。
2. 多视角融合
稳态视觉系统会从多个视角捕捉物体图像,通过融合这些图像,提高视觉稳定性。
3. 深度学习
深度学习技术在稳态视觉中发挥着重要作用。通过训练神经网络,机器人可以学会在动态环境中识别和跟踪物体。
稳态视觉的应用
稳态视觉技术在机器人领域有着广泛的应用,以下列举几个实例:
1. 自动驾驶
稳态视觉技术可以帮助自动驾驶汽车在复杂路况下,准确识别和跟踪道路标志、行人和其他车辆。
2. 工业机器人
稳态视觉技术可以提高工业机器人的定位精度,使其在执行装配、焊接等任务时更加准确。
3. 无人机
稳态视觉技术可以帮助无人机在飞行过程中,稳定地捕捉地面目标,实现精确投放。
总结
机器人视觉系统是机器人感知世界的重要手段。稳态视觉技术通过预测与补偿、多视角融合和深度学习等手段,使机器人在动态环境中保持视觉稳定性,从而提高其感知和执行任务的能力。随着技术的不断发展,机器人视觉系统将在更多领域发挥重要作用。
